Here is test code that is testing our behavior on non existing connector:

{code}
    new TestDescription("Get connector by non-existing ID", "v1/connector/666", 
"GET", null, new Validator() {
      @Override
      void validate() throws Exception {
        assertResponseCode(500);
        
assertServerException("org.apache.sqoop.error.code.CommonRepositoryError", 
"COMMON_0057");
      }}),
    new TestDescription("Get connector by non-existing name", 
"v1/connector/jarcecs-cool-connector", "GET", null, new Validator() {
      @Override
      void validate() throws Exception {
        assertResponseCode(500);
        assertServerException("org.apache.sqoop.server.common.ServerError", 
"SERVER_0005");
      }}),
{code}

Depending whether one asks for non-existing connector ID or non-existing 
connector name, he gets different answer. That seems really weird for single 
REST end point and I think that we should fix that.
